Here are some ways to fix Genshin Impact Application Error 0xc0000102 on Windows:
1. Update your drivers. Outdated drivers can sometimes cause Genshin Impact to crash. Make sure that you have the latest drivers installed for your graphics card, sound card, and other hardware devices. 2. Repair the game files. If Genshin Impact is still crashing, you can try repairing the game files. Open the Epic Games Launcher, go to the Library, and select Genshin Impact. Click the three dots next to the game's name and select "Repair."
3. Uninstall then reinstall the game. If all else fails, you can try reinstalling Genshin Impact. This will erase all of the game's files and settings, so make sure that you have a backup of your progress.
If you are still having trouble, you can contact Genshin Impact support for further assistance.
